I am a US Citizen married to a Czech National. We submitted the 130/485/765 at the local office in NYC, 26 Federal Plaza. We had our interview on June 16, 2005 in Garden City and, like so many others, were told that our case could not be approved because the security clearance was not complete.

Today, I received an automatic email update from USCIS that our 130 was approved. I checked the status on our 485 and the system could not find the record (I check everyday, and the message that "the results of our fingerprints ...... " message was there yesterday). Can someone tell me what an approved 130 means in relation to getting a green card? Does it mean that the security clearance is done? Can we use the 130 approval notice to get my wife's passport stamped?

I 130 approval means that the officer has agreed to approve your case upon receiving your Name Check. No, this does not qualify you for stamp in passport. Sorry.... I am in the same boat...
